NNL Board Meeting Endorses NFF Leadership and Approves Annual General Meeting


By Usman Abdul
Abuja, Nigeria – The Nigeria National League (NNL) Board of Directors held a virtual meeting on September 4, 2024, to discuss the league’s progress and future plans. The board expressed its appreciation for the Nigeria Football Federation (NFF) under the leadership of Alhaji Ibrahim Musa Gusau for providing a conducive environment for the NNL to thrive.
The board also expressed its confidence in the NFF’s efforts to ensure that the Super Eagles qualify for both the 2025 Africa Cup of Nations and the 2026 FIFA World Cup.
In terms of the NNL itself, the board resolved to hold the annual general meeting of clubs in September 2024. The specific date and venue for the meeting will be announced at a later time.
Furthermore, the board decided to maintain an equal number of teams in each conference for the upcoming 2024/2025 league season.
The meeting was attended by a majority of the board members, with only Engr Dotun Sanusi being absent. The communique was signed by Dr. Donald Ikpe, Chairman of the Communique Drafting Committee, Alh Sani Mohammed, and Dr. Ayo Abdulrahaman, Secretary.
